iii. The optimum time to grow walnuts

Planting a walnut tree in the fall is the best option if you want to maximize root development before winter frosts. However, if bought in a planter, it can be planted in the spring or even the summer, provided that hot, humid weather is avoided.

v. Expand the Seasonal Offerings

Stores have been urged to seek outside of the traditional American holiday opportunities to boost sales of walnuts.

American Heart Month (February) has proven to be a successful promotional month, and many businesses now incorporate it in their fashion brand calendars, according to Ladhoff. According to CWB, more than 6,100 supermarkets exhibited walnuts in their produce departments with heart-healthy messaging during the CWB's American Heart Month campaign in February.

According to Ladhoff, CWB is planning a multi-million-dollar campaign in 2021 to promote the eating of walnuts.

vi. Needed Space

Choosing the right property for commercial walnut growing is quite crucial. Soils rich in compost and lime-supplemented deep silt loam or clay are ideal for earning walnut wholesale price because they drain well.

Soil with a pH of 6.0 to 7.5 is ideal for growing walnuts. Optimal yields can be achieved when the soil is rich in micronutrients.
